So I am trying to plot this log function, but nothing is being plotted on the graph. The figure pops up, but there is nothing on the figure. I know that it's mainly because my Zeq matrix values are getting NaN + NaNi but I am not sure how to fix that
My Code is below:
f = logspace(10, 10E9);
C1 = 2.33E-10;
Cox = 4.77E-5;
C = 2.8E-15;
g2 = 1/(4*10^-3E-3)*(Cox).*f;
g1 = 1/(4*10^-3E-3)*(C).*f;
L1 = 0.0118;
r1 = 1.42;
r = 6.818E-6.*sqrt(f);
s = 1i*2*pi.*f;
x = 1./((g2+(1./(s.*C1)).*(r1 + 1./(s.*Cox))) ./ (g2+(1./(s.*C1))+(r1 + 1./(s.*Cox))));
y = r + s.*L1 + ((g1./(g1.*s*C) + 1));
z = 1./y;
Zeq = 1./(x+z);
loglog(f,abs(Zeq));
grid on;

The logspace call is wrong.
If you want ‘f’ to go from 10 to , call it as:
f = logspace(1, 9, 50);
That creates a 50-element vector between those limits.
